Les enseignements de l'expérience corse en matière de continuité territoriale : des exigences fortes en matière de régulation et de gouvernance

Abstract

La Corse bénéficie d'un système de continuité territoriale (CT) depuis 35 ans. Globalement, celui-ci a permis une nette amélioration des communications entre l'île et la France continentale. Il a aussi contribué activement à l'évolution économique du territoire insulaire. Mais son bilan économique et financier est loin d'être parfait. Son coût de fonctionnement, notamment, paraît excessif. Les dysfonctionnements qui le pénalisent semblent pouvoir être repérés dans deux registres distincts mais complémentaires. Celui de la gouvernance territoriale d'une part, et celui de la régulation des activités de transport d'autre part.
